Roasted Chicken, Greek Style

Categories: Frugal03

Serves: 4 servings

Ingredients:
Instructions:
Marinate the chicken in the above mixture for 1 hour, being sure to rub
some inside the chicken. Bake at 375 degrees for 1 hour or until done. If
you want to do this on a barbecue it is best to cut the bird in half the
long way, then marinate. Cook to your liking over medium-hot coals. This
recipe serves 4.

Comments: The wonderful thing about Greek cooking is that it is rarely
complex. You can bake this chicken or cut it in half to place on the
barbecue. Either way is most enjoyable and the olive oil helps keep it
moist.
